BRENDA MARTIN is now in the hospital unit in the Mexican jail in which she has languished for 2 years. Apparently charged with being an accessory in a fraud case involving her former employer (who has stated that she was not at any time involved in his nefarious doings), MARTIN was not permitted a lawyer or a translator when she was brought before a judge. Her human rights were trampled upon, according to her lawyer, and her friend in Trenton, Ontario.
Her appeal to this injustice was denied early this week.
As MARTIN languishes in jail, now at 90 pounds, the Minister says she has send "notes" to the Mexican government, and is now powerless to do anything more.
